Instructions. Combine all of the brine ingredients in a medium pot. Bring to a simmer and whisk to make sure that the salt is completely dissolved. Remove from heat and allow the brine to cool completely. Add pork chops to the brine and refrigerate for 1-4 hours (or a quick brine for at least 30 minutes).

Sage and Rosemary Pork Chops Recipe

Preheat the oven to 400° F. Grease a baking pan with oil. Place the pork chops on the baking dish. Place the pork chops in the oven and bake for 25 minutes, or until the pork chops reach a temperature of 145° F on a meat thermometer. Remove from the oven. Allow the pork chops to rest for 4-5 minutes before serving.
